Promising the ability to play PS4 games on PC, these sites often require users to complete invasive surveys, download adware, or hand over personal/financial information.
When you look for a "pcsx4 github link" online, you will likely stumble upon slick, professional-looking websites that claim to offer a working PS4 emulator. They will boast high frame rates, 4K resolution upscaling, and support for the entire PS4 catalog.
Because GitHub allows anyone to create a free account and upload files, scammers often host fake "PCSX4" or fake "PS5 Emulator" repositories there to look official. Protect yourself by looking for these red flags:
The platform often claims you need to dump a "PlayStation Device Identifier" (PDIX) or system encryption keys from a physical PS4 console using their custom tools. In reality, this process acts as an IDPS console-key harvester, which can compromise real PlayStation hardware credentials.
Once a user attempts to download the software, they are met with several red flags:
When you download the file, it typically gives you an extraction error or asks for a "PS4 Decryption Key." Successfully emulating a console like the PlayStation 4 is an astronomically complex task, far beyond the capabilities of a single scammer. The PS4 is an x86-64-based machine, which is different from the more esoteric hardware of older consoles like the PS2 or PS3. This architectural similarity to a PC is a double-edged sword; while it sounds promising, emulating the PS4's entire custom operating system, security kernels, and unique libraries is a monumental challenge.
